I find this decision to be very player dependent. Has he raised his drawing hand before? Would he have raised or called on the flop with a made flush? How good is his game? Does he know that he is effectively isolating you and would he do that with a drawing hand?

In many live games against a loose player who can be aggressive post-flop, a C/C, C/C is a good enough line and you will win often enough with TPMK. If a spade falls, you need to decide whether you can represent the big spade and get him to fold... again, very player and read dependent.
